A flange is a way to connect valves, pipes, pumps and other equipment to form a system of pipes. It provides access to modification, inspection or cleaning. They can be screwed or welded. Joining two flanges with a particular type of seal can put their joints together.
– Blind Flange
– Threaded Flange
– Lap-Joint Flange
– Socket-welded Flange
– Slip-on Flange
– Welded-neck Flange
Pipe flanges are made of materials like cast iron, stainless steel, bronze, aluminum, plastic and many others. However, most of them have machined surfaces and are forged carbon steel. Moreover, flanges are equipped with layers of material of an entirely different quality for specific purposes.

Stainless Steel 304L Flanges are highly valuable for joining pipes, valves and other apparatus in piping systems. They are made from grade 304L stainless steel, which offers excellent corrosion resistance to oxidizing and reducing environments. When used in low or medium-pressure applications, these flanges provide excellent leak tightness and strength. They have a high-temperature tolerance, making them suitable for many industries such as automotive, medical, food processing and construction. Stainless Steel 304L Flanges boast exceptional durability and are ideal for highly demanding applications due to their superior strength-to-weight ratio.
Stainless Steel 304l Flanges are types of flanges used for various applications. These flanges are fabricated from austenitic stainless steel grade 304l, one of the most versatile and widely used grades of stainless steel. The corrosion resistance properties of this grade make it ideal for use in industries prone to harsh environmental conditions, such as oil refineries, coastal areas, and chemical plants. This type of flange is also resistant to oxidation up to 870°C. Depending on the application requirements, there are different types of Stainless Steel 304l Flanges available, including Slip-On Flanges, Threaded Flanges, Socket Welding Flanges, Blind Flange & Lap Joints Face (RTJ), Orifice Flange & Ring Type Joints (RTJ).
Because of their exceptional corrosion resistance, Stainless Steel 304l flanges are suitable for use in numerous industries such as food processing, chemical and petrochemical, textile and pharmaceutical, pulp, and paper. Moreover, because of their high-temperature resistance properties, Stainless Steel 304l flanges are widely used in the nuclear industry.
One of the primary advantages of Stainless Steel 304l flanges is their excellent corrosion resistance. Additionally, these flanges offer high-temperature resistance, making them suitable for use in high-temperature applications. Moreover, these flanges are strong and durable, so they can withstand heavy loads, making them ideal for industrial applications.
